Sports Massage Explained

  What is Sports Massage? Sports Massage is very hands-on and incorporates a variety of techniques to help positively influence the body’s soft tissues such as muscle, tendon and fascia.  It relieves problematic muscle tension, scar tissue and adhesions by breaking them down.  This can improve function, mobility and provide pain relief. Vestibular Rehabilitation Explained

What is Vestibular Rehabilitation? Vestibular Rehabilitation is the diagnosis and treatment of dizziness and imbalance often as a result of problems of the inner ear.  At the Rehab Hub it is provided by Annie Head, who has over ten years experience in this field.
